Overview
The position is responsible for the creation of reports and materials and performing preliminary analysis of data to identify trends that will drive strategic reviews and supplier business development. In addition, this position will also provide support for supplier meeting coordination.
Responsibilities
Acts as a liaison between business managers, division managers, human resources and finance to facilitate the end-to-end goal model process.
- Receives goals from business managers and performs goal entry
- Assists in goal attainment through reporting, provision of data to help determine segmentation and supporting data-entry
- Functions as the market CPG administrator, creating accounts and performing maintenance and update activities as necessary
- Assists in the administration of other sales tools, including Seven Fifty and Provi
- Ensures adherence to goal model timelines
- Administrative tasks related to goal model, including, but not limited to: sales sheet uploads, manual adjustments to SOP templates, creation of goal vetting templates
- Ensure the data integrity of SOP and FSM accountability data
- Serves as the market SME and point-of-contact for goal model processes and questions
- Troubleshoots and works with business managers and sales leadership to correct goal entry issues
- Participates in and facilitates goal vetting meetings with business managers and sales leadership
- In advance of cycle-end goal SOP meetings, assists sales leadership in the preparation of goal observation reports, mobility metrics
- Maintains accuracy of focus marketing data by processing change requests
- Assists business managers in compiling and preparing regular supplier recaps
